GUARDIANS OF THE GALAXY claim no. 1

4 Aug 2014

Singapore - Marvel Studios score their second no. 1 of the year as GUARDIANS OF THE GALAXY debuts at the top with US$1,785,046 from 101 screens (including 3D and IMAX 3D) for a strong US$17,674 screen average. It's the 7th highest debut of the year and the highest for a film that's not a sequel or a reboot of an existing franchise. It's also the 14th film to debut above US$1m this year.

Other entrants include the airline horror mystery thriller 7500 (US$142,980; US$250,696 including sneaks / 13 screens), THE WHITE HAIRED WITCH OF LUNAR KINGDOM 白发魔女专之明月天国 starring Fan Bingbing (US$107,291 / 19 screens); Korean erotic drama OBSESSED starring Song Seung-Heon (US$45,670 / 5 screens); Thai horror HONG HOON (US$17,123 / 10 screens) and Rob Reiner's comedy drama romance AND SO IT GOES (US$11,280 / 3 screens).

The Taiwanese romance comedy APOLITICAL ROMANCE 对面的那女孩杀过来 has collected US$9,083 from a single screen after two weekends (figures unavailable last week).

Overall, the Top 10 films grossed US$2,660,924 - a 28% increase from last weekend and a 25.87% increase from the same frame a year ago when THE WOLVERINE spent a 2nd weekend at no. 1.
